The Role & Duties Your role will report into the Network & Security Project Manager and provide support on a wide range of exciting new projects. The main project being delivered at the moment is a network security project relating to all the operational technology within the business. This project involves working with teams around the world led out of Australia, and in New Zealand working closely with a tight knit team of 4.
In this role you are also responsible for implementing, monitoring, and managing the local and wide area networks of an organisation to ensure maximum uptime for users. This position will involve supporting system configurations, documenting and managing the installation of a new network, and maintaining and upgrading existing systems as necessary. There is flexibility with working hours if commuting from Auckland CBD as long as you can still produce the deliverables required, however this is a predominately onsite role.
You will also participate in an on-call roster within a team of 4 (1 in every 4 weeks) as this site operates 24/7. Skills & Experience Network Security Expertise: Experience with tools such as Fortigate, CheckPoint, or similar is a must. Analytical Prowess: Your excellent analytical skills are essential for success in this role.
Technical Wizardry: Proficiency in at least two of the following technologies: MS Suite (MS Windows 2016, MS Windows 2019, MS Active Directory, MS Exchange, MS Terminal Server), Networking/DNS Services. Lifelong Learner: We value a willingness to learn and adapt, especially in our exceptionally supportive team environment. Certifications: CCNP, CCNA and firewall certs for Fortigate or Checkpoint.
Beneficial: Experience with OT highly desirable, however not a 'deal breaker'.
